First is the need to figure out what your business is going to be that you're marketing online. Well, that's not too hard. What you want to do is find a niche in which to build your online marketing business first. This is quite easy if you have some time to conduct the proper keyword research with Yahoo Overture's Keyword Suggestion Tool or if you have software like Niche Inspector, which can actually cut your online marketing research time down to minutes.
Once you've found your niche, find the top five or six forums within it (by going to any search engine and typing in "[keyword] forums"), then read what the forum members are saying about what they want or don't understand. Once you have an idea of what that is, fill the need! Sometimes you have to create an information product, but very often you can find an affiliate product to sell to them. Then, it's just a matter of putting your online marketing skills to work and writing a few auto responder messages, putting the form on a landing page, then putting it out there for everyone.

If you want quick traffic, you want to use Pay-Per-Click ads. Just be sure that you are sending folks to a landing page of your own and offer them something of value for buying from your affiliate site. Then redirect them there by having them sign in with their name and email so that you can send them reminders with your auto responder. Promotional articles are a good way to get long term traffic and is an integral part (or should be) of your online marketing priorities list. Find the most searched keyword for your product and build your articles around it. Use it in the title and early and often in the body. Give good information, and you'll likely get published. Once again, send your people to a landing page with more information about the product that can redirect them where you want them to go. You don't want to send them directly to an affiliate page- that's tacky, unprofessional, and publishers don't like it.
